Soup for One recipes

Yesterday, I was searching for some recipes for "one"...especially soup or anything I could microwave...I ran across a couple of ideas and this is what I came up with...I got everything I needed for less than $20 and I used coupons, too...I was able to measure everything out to make 6 individual chicken noodle soups, 6 vegetable beef soups and 4 potato soups...I put everything into sandwich sized zip lock bags and put them in the freezer...I made one of the vegetable beef soups for lunch and it tasted like I spent all day on it and it only took about 10 minutes to cook and I didn't have to add any salt or pepper!...(I tried the potato soup the next day and it was yummy!)...enjoy! (I already had cheese, milk, bacon bits, dried parsley flakes, dried celery flakes and dried minced onion. The bouillon granules were cheaper in the Hispanic section where I found the noodles.)

Chicken Noodle Soup
Divide the following ingredients into 6 zip lock sandwich bags:

1- 7oz bag of Moderna Fideo noodles (with the Hispanic foods) You can use egg noodles if you prefer
1- small bag of Tyson Ready Grill Chicken Breast strips (cut into small cubes)
1 - snack size carrot, celery and broccoli veggie tray (slice celery and baby carrots thinly and place about a teaspoon in each bag, eat the broccoli and dip while you work, LOL)
Place 1 teaspoon of chicken bouillon granules in each bag
Sprinkle a little parsley flakes on top.
Seal bag and freeze until ready to use.

To cook, add 1 and 1/2 cups of water, bring to a boil and then simmer until noodles are done. Enjoy!

Vegetable Beef soup
Divide the following ingredients into 6 zip lock sandwich bags:

1 - 16 oz. bag of frozen mixed veggies (I got the ones with the green beans)
1 - 20 oz. bag of Simply Potatoes, diced potatoes and onions (in the dairy section, by the eggbeaters)
*I only added about 10 potatoes to each bag. I saved the rest for the potato soup.
1- small bag of Tyson Ready Grill Seasoned Steak strips (cut into small pieces)
Place 1 teaspoon of beef bouillon granules in each bag
Sprinkle a little parsley flakes and dried minced onion on top.
Seal bag and freeze until ready to use.

To cook, add 1 and 1/2 cups of water, bring to a boil and then simmer until veggies are done to your likeness. Enjoy!

Potato soup
Divide the following ingredients into 4 zip lock sandwich bags:

1 - 20 oz. bag of Simply Potatoes, diced potatoes and onions (in the dairy section, by the eggbeaters)
*if you don't make the vegetable beef soup, you can probably make 2 extra bags of potato soup
Place one teaspoon of chicken bouillon granules in each bag.
Sprinkle a little dried parsley flakes, dried celery flakes and dried minced onion on top.
Seal bag and freeze until ready to use.

To cook, add 1 cup of water, bring to a boil and then simmer until potatoes are done. Add 1/2 a cup of milk or cream and a little butter or margarine (I used about a tablespoon), do not boil, simmer a few more minutes. Remove from heat and garnish with shredded cheddar cheese and bacon bits, if you like. You can mash the potatoes to thicken the soup if you'd like. Enjoy!
